Riyo, an orphaned 17-year old, sails from Yokohama to Hawaii in 1918 to marry Matsuji, a man she has never met. Hoping to escape a troubled past and start anew, Riyo is bitterly disappointed upon her arrival: her husband is twice her age. The miserable girl finds solace with her new friend Kana, a young mother who helps Riyo accept her new life.

A young woman arrives in Hawaii as a mail-order bride to a stranger, only to discover her dreams of escape have led to a different kind of confinement, but finds unexpected kinship and wisdom in an unlikely friendship. It's a quiet, tender story about learning to make a home where you didn't expect to find one.
